ERP系统 & MES 生产管理系统
10万用户实施案例,ERP 系统实现微信、销售、库存、生产、财务、人资、办公等一体化管理
ERP系统操作指南与二次开发支持
在当今企业信息化建设中,ERP(企业资源计划)系统的应用已经成为众多企业管理的重要工具。随着企业规模的扩展和业务需求的多样化,许多公司选择根据自己的实际情况对ERP系统进行二次开发,从而增强其灵活性与可扩展性。那么,ERP系统操作指南是否支持二次开发使用呢?本文将围绕这一问题展开讨论,详细探讨ERP系统二次开发的相关内容,帮助企业了解二次开发的重要性、实施过程以及如何在操作指南中进行有效支持。
什么是ERP系统二次开发
二次开发是指在ERP系统的基础上,根据企业的具体需求进行的功能扩展和定制化开发。这种开发不仅仅局限于ERP系统的标准功能,还包括了对系统界面、数据库、报表等多个方面的个性化调整。ERP系统的二次开发主要通过修改系统的源代码或者通过配置与集成,来满足企业的业务需求。因此,二次开发的成功与否,直接关系到企业信息化建设的效率与质量。
ERP系统操作指南对二次开发的支持
许多ERP系统在操作指南中会明确提到是否支持二次开发。一般来说,较为成熟的ERP系统都会提供开发者手册和技术文档,指导开发人员如何进行二次开发。对于企业来说,这些操作指南至关重要,它们不仅为技术人员提供了详细的开发流程,还确保了二次开发过程中不会影响到系统的稳定性和安全性。
ERP系统二次开发的优势
1. 满足特定业务需求
不同的企业有不同的管理模式和业务流程,通过二次开发,ERP系统可以根据企业的个性化需求进行功能调整,确保系统与企业的实际业务高度契合。
2. 提升系统灵活性
标准的ERP系统虽然能满足大部分企业的基本需求,但在一些特殊业务场景中可能存在局限。二次开发能够提高ERP系统的灵活性,使其适应不同的业务需求和变化。
3. 提高操作效率
通过二次开发,可以对ERP系统的操作界面进行优化,简化操作流程,减少重复性工作,进而提高员工的工作效率。
4. 增强数据分析能力
ERP系统集成了大量的数据,通过二次开发,企业可以定制化的报表和数据分析功能,帮助管理层做出更为精准的决策。
ERP系统二次开发的实施过程
1. 需求分析与功能定义
在进行二次开发之前,企业需要先进行需求分析,明确自己在业务流程中存在的痛点和需求。通过与相关部门的沟通,确定ERP系统需要扩展的功能或优化的部分。
2. 技术评估与选型
在明确需求之后,企业需要评估现有的ERP系统是否支持二次开发。如果ERP系统本身不支持二次开发,企业可能需要考虑其他系统或进行系统升级。同时,企业还需要选定合适的开发工具和技术方案。
3. 开发与测试
开发人员在操作指南的指导下,开始进行二次开发工作。开发过程中需要严格遵循系统的架构设计,避免对原有功能产生冲突。开发完成后,必须进行充分的测试,确保新功能的稳定性和兼容性。
4. 部署与维护
二次开发完成后,需要将新功能部署到生产环境中。在部署过程中,必须确保不会对现有业务流程造成影响。后期还需要定期维护和更新,以确保系统的长期稳定运行。
ERP系统操作指南中的二次开发注意事项
1. 版本管理
在进行二次开发时,要特别注意ERP系统的版本管理。对于ERP系统的每一次升级,都可能导致二次开发的部分功能无法兼容。因此,开发人员需要在升级前进行充分的兼容性测试,确保系统升级后,二次开发部分不会出现问题。
2. 数据安全性
由于ERP系统涉及大量的企业数据,二次开发时一定要特别注意数据的安全性。在进行功能扩展时,要确保系统的权限控制和数据加密机制不会被破坏,防止敏感数据泄露。
3. 开发文档的完整性
对于二次开发的过程和结果,开发人员必须编写详细的技术文档。这些文档不仅仅是开发人员的参考资料,也是后期维护人员的宝贵资源。开发文档应包括开发背景、功能说明、系统架构、测试用例等内容。
4. 与ERP厂商的合作
如果在二次开发过程中遇到技术难题,企业可以与ERP厂商的技术支持团队进行合作。大部分ERP厂商都提供技术咨询服务,帮助企业解决开发中的问题。
总结
总的来说,ERP系统的操作指南在二次开发过程中起着至关重要的作用。企业在实施二次开发时,必须要充分了解操作指南中的相关内容,按照规范流程进行开发。通过二次开发,企业可以更好地满足自身的管理需求,提升工作效率和决策能力。然而,二次开发也需要谨慎操作,避免对系统稳定性和数据安全性产生负面影响。对于许多企业来说,二次开发是一个不断优化和创新的过程,在这个过程中,企业能够通过灵活的调整,使ERP系统更好地服务于自己的发展目标。


咨询顾问